~postmarketos/pmbootstrap-devel

pmbootstrap: pmb.helpers.frontend: Also clear testsuite log when running log -c v1 APPLIED

Newbyte: 1
 pmb.helpers.frontend: Also clear testsuite log when running log -c

 1 files changed, 3 insertions(+), 1 deletions(-)
#1000738 .build.yml success
Export patchset (mbox)
How do I use this?

Copy & paste the following snippet into your terminal to import this patchset into git:

curl -s https://lists.sr.ht/~postmarketos/pmbootstrap-devel/patches/41613/mbox | git am -3
Learn more about email & git

[PATCH pmbootstrap] pmb.helpers.frontend: Also clear testsuite log when running log -c Export this patch

---
 pmb/helpers/frontend.py |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/pmb/helpers/frontend.py b/pmb/helpers/frontend.py
index c9b76ab6..d8d80bff 100644
--- a/pmb/helpers/frontend.py
+++ b/pmb/helpers/frontend.py
@@ -531,14 +531,16 @@ def work_migrate(args):


def log(args):
    log_testsuite = f"{args.work}/log_testsuite.txt"

    if args.clear_log:
        pmb.helpers.run.user(args, ["truncate", "-s", "0", args.log])
        pmb.helpers.run.user(args, ["truncate", "-s", "0", log_testsuite])

    cmd = ["tail", "-n", args.lines, "-F"]

    # Follow the testsuite's log file too if it exists. It will be created when
    # starting a test case that writes to it (git -C test grep log_testsuite).
    log_testsuite = f"{args.work}/log_testsuite.txt"
    if os.path.exists(log_testsuite):
        cmd += [log_testsuite]

-- 
2.40.1

Applied, thanks!

[1/1] pmb.helpers.frontend: Also clear testsuite log when running log -c
      commit: 09870a46a0892e29b54eee7419046186d42504c1

Best regards
pmbootstrap/patches/.build.yml: SUCCESS in 20m44s

[pmb.helpers.frontend: Also clear testsuite log when running log -c][0] from [Newbyte][1]

[0]: https://lists.sr.ht/~postmarketos/pmbootstrap-devel/patches/41613
[1]: mailto:newbyte@postmarketos.org

✓ #1000738 SUCCESS pmbootstrap/patches/.build.yml https://builds.sr.ht/~postmarketos/job/1000738